4th Clutch Transmission Fluid Pressure Switch Replacement

- Disconnect the connector from the 4th clutch transmission fluid pressure switch (A).
- Replace the 4th clutch transmission fluid pressure switch, then install a new one with a new sealing washer (B). Tighten the switch on the metal part, not the plastic part.
- Reconnect the connector, making sure there is no water, oil, dust, or other foreign particles inside it.
